Wines and Spirits by Leslie William Marrison is a comprehensive exploration of alcoholic beverages, published by Penguin in 1973. This third edition spans 335 pages and is presented in English. The book delves into various aspects of cooking and beverages, focusing specifically on wine and spirits, providing readers with a detailed understanding of these subjects.
